Did you know that there are well over 100 different symptoms that can accompany your arthritis? Many younger people will attribute the aching of a joint or pain in their wrist to a sort of sports or work-related injury, when in fact they are suffering from a degenerative disease.
Those who suffer from arthritis generally have at least one of these more common complaints that are associated with the disease:
- Joint pain that does not seem to fade
- Tenderness and pain in a joint if it moves (this can be walking, writing, typing, or any other sort of typical daily activity)
- Swelling and inflammation around the joint, which may include redness and skin that is “warm to touch”
- Joint deformity (this is particularly apparent in toes and fingers)
- Lack of flexibility or ROM (range of motion)
- Fatigue, or feeling “low”

If you’re here looking for shingles remedies, chances are that you are suffering from some of the common symptoms of shingles. Before looking into natural remedies, it is important to understand what shingles actually are.
So What Are Shingles?
Shingles are often referred to as “grown up chickenpox” as they are caused by the same virus. This virus, the Varicella zoster virus causes a rash to break out on one’s skin. If you have ever had chickenpox, this virus then lives in your nervous system until the end of time and can, under certain circumstances (such as stress, cancer, or an immune deficiency) “reactivate” and cause you to break out into shingles.
Though anyone at any age can develop shingles, it is more commonly seen in adults over 60.

Want to lose weight but not sure where to begin? Food portion control is an easy and effective way for you to start shedding your pounds and it will also help you maintain your ideal weight (when reached) in the future. The problem is, most people do not even know how to properly portion their food any more, given the immense portions we receive in restaurants these days. How can we keep our food portions under control?
Salads Are Your Best Friend
Before any meal begins, open it with a salad. The general rule when it comes to food portion control is that you can eat as many vegetables as you would like, though be sure to take it easy with the salad dressing and dips. Try to aim at adding only 1 tablespoon of salad dressing to your salads, no matter if it is vinaigrette or fattier, creamier dressings. Remember, the goal here is learning food portion control, and salad dressing counts as a food!
Meat Is NOT The Main Course
When we focus on meat being a main course, we tend to double or triple our portions of meat. Look at your plate and think about food portion control. Half of that plate should be vegetables. That leaves the other half open for grains, meats, dairy – whatever you choose to fill it with. When it comes to meat and food portion control, aim to have meat on your plate that is no larger than the palm of your hand (approximately 4 oz.). Your body requires no more than that.
Food Portion Control Means More Meals
Eating more frequently throughout the day will help you with your weight loss goals. Keeping your stomach full also helps keep your sugar levels up, which both gives you energy and prevents you from making rash food choices (you won’t feel tempted to pull into that fast food joint if you have a full stomach now, will you?). Four to six small meals – being sure that one is breakfast – will keep your metabolism running high and your body satisfied.

High blood pressure is more common than you may think which is why more and more people are going out and seeking high blood pressure natural remedies. The American Heart Association says that up to one in three American adults have high blood pressure, though even more frightening is that one-third of those are not even aware that it is affecting them.
What is high blood pressure?
High blood pressure natural remedies should be sought by anyone having a blood pressure above 120/80mmHg. There are 3 different stages of high blood pressure:
• Prehypertension: a systolic pressure ranging from 120 to 139, or a diastolic pressure ranging from 80 to 89. These people would benefit from more mild remedies
• Stage 1 hypertension: This involves a systolic pressure from 140 to 159, or a diastolic pressure from 90 to 99. These people are at moderate risk for health complications and so should be more active in seeking natural remedies.
• Stage 2 hypertension: This is the highest and more dangerous stage for those needing high blood pressure natural remedies. One’s systolic pressure will be higher than 160 or the diastolic pressure will be 100 and above.
What are some of the best high blood pressure natural remedies?
There are several high blood pressure natural remedies out there, though the best place to start is to completely change your life style. Some of these preventative measures include:
• Reduce Your Weight. The more overweight you are, the more pressure you are putting on your artery walls. Your heart must then pump harder and faster to squeeze the blood necessary to the places it has to go.
• Activity: Increase your activity level to strengthen your heart!
• Smoking: Cigarettes are loaded with poisons that damage and thin out our artery walls, again forcing your heart to work harder to get the job done.
• Cut down on salts: Sodium leads to fluid retention which can lead to high blood pressure, so stay away from your salty snacks and opt for natural whole foods instead.
• Reduce Stress. Anyone who’s stressed will tell you they can literally feel their heart begin to race. Natural relaxation techniques such as massage and diaphragmatic breathing are fantastic high blood pressure natural remedies.
• Reduce Your Alcohol Consumption. Excessive alcohol usage has been linked to many heart-related ailments.
